Partager via


Créer un abonnement piloté par les données (didacticiel SSRS)

Reporting Services fournit des abonnements pilotés par les données afin que vous puissiez personnaliser la distribution d’un rapport en fonction des données d’abonné dynamiques. Les abonnements pilotés par les données s'utilisent dans les types de scénarios suivants :

  • Distribution de rapports à un large ensemble de destinataires dont les membres peuvent changer d'une distribution à l'autre. Par exemple, distribution d'un rapport mensuel à l'ensemble des clients actuels.

  • Distribution de rapports à un groupe spécifique de destinataires sur la base de critères prédéfinis. Par exemple, envoi d'un rapport sur les résultats des ventes aux dix premiers directeurs commerciaux d'une organisation.

Contenu du didacticiel

Ce didacticiel explique comment utiliser les abonnements pilotés par les données à l'aide d'un exemple simple qui illustre les concepts de base.

Ce didacticiel est divisé en trois leçons :

Leçon 1 : Création d’un exemple de base de données d’abonnés
Dans cette leçon, vous allez apprendre à créer une base de données SQL Server locale qui contient des informations sur l’abonné.

Leçon 2 : Modification des propriétés de la source de données de rapport
Dans cette leçon, vous allez apprendre à modifier les propriétés d'une source de données afin que le rapport puisse s'exécuter sans assistance. Les informations d'identification stockées sont nécessaires pour le traitement autonome. Vous allez également modifier le dataset du rapport afin d'inclure un paramètre fourni par les données d'abonné.

Leçon 3 : Définition d’un abonnement piloté par les données
Dans cette leçon, vous allez apprendre à définir un abonnement piloté par les données. Cette leçon vous guide à travers chaque page de l'Assistant Abonnement piloté par les données.

Spécifications

Les abonnements pilotés par les données sont généralement créés par un administrateur de serveur de rapports, qui en assure également la mise à jour. Pour créer des abonnements pilotés par les données, il est nécessaire de savoir créer des requêtes, de connaître les sources de données qui contiennent les données d'abonnés et de disposer d'autorisations élevées sur le serveur de rapports.

Le tutoriel utilise le rapport créé dans le didacticiel Créer un rapport de table de base (tutoriel SSRS) et les données d’AdventureWorks2012

Les éléments suivants doivent cependant être installés sur votre système :

  • Une édition de SQL Server qui prend en charge les abonnements pilotés par les données. Pour plus d’informations, consultez Éditions et composants de SQL Server 2014.

  • Le serveur de rapports doit être exécuté en mode natif. L'interface utilisateur décrite dans ce didacticiel est basée sur un serveur de rapports en mode natif. Les abonnements sont pris en charge sur les serveurs de rapports en mode SharePoint, mais l'interface utilisateur sera différente de ce qui est décrit dans ce didacticiel.

  • Le service Agent SQL Server doit être en cours d'exécution.

  • Rapport contenant des paramètres. Ce tutoriel suppose l’utilisation de l’exemple de rapport Sales Orders que vous créez à l’aide du tutoriel Créer un rapport de tableau de base (tutoriel SSRS).

  • Exemple de base de données AdventureWorks2012 , qui fournit des données à l’exemple de rapport.

  • Attribution de rôle incluant la tâche Gérer tous les abonnements dans le rapport fourni en exemple. Cette tâche est obligatoire dans la définition des abonnements pilotés par les données. Si vous êtes l'administrateur de l'ordinateur, l'attribution de rôle par défaut pour les administrateurs locaux fournit les autorisations nécessaires à la création d'abonnements pilotés par les données. Pour plus d’informations, consultez Octroi d'autorisations sur un serveur de rapports en mode natif.

  • Dossier partagé pour lequel vous bénéficiez de droits d'accès en écriture. Le dossier partagé doit être accessible via une connexion réseau.

Durée estimée pour effectuer le tutoriel : 30 minutes. Trente minutes supplémentaires si vous n'avez pas étudié le didacticiel de création d'un rapport de base.

Voir aussi

Abonnements pilotés par les données
Créer un rapport de tableau de base (didacticiel SSRS)